Co-op Student, Mechanical Engineering | CMTA, a Legence Company
The Tone:
This is a full-time, onsite Co-op Student position at CMTA, a Legence Company, located in Lafayette, CA, starting in May 2026. CMTA is a fast-growing engineering firm known for its expertise in sustainable, high-performance building engineering, taking a data-driven approach to consulting engineering and zero energy projects. Legence, its parent company, provides engineering, consulting, installation, and maintenance services for critical building systems, enhancing energy efficiency and sustainability. This role offers unique hands-on training to teach you how CMTA engineers design and implement mechanical systems and energy-efficient measures in building projects.

What You’ll Actually Do
• Layout: Produce detailed layout and equipment details for HVAC systems.
• Schematics: Produce one-line diagrams and schematics for various systems.
• Documentation: Assist the design team in the process of assembling organized sets of engineering drawings.
• Verification: May assist in data collection activities and field verification processes.
• Project Development: Work in conjunction with designers and engineers to help develop all aspects of a project.
The Must-Haves
• Background: Currently pursuing a Bachelor of Mechanical Engineering or Architectural Engineering, preferably as a sophomore (2nd year) or junior (3rd year), with a strong interest in Building Systems Mechanical Engineering.
• Experience: Ability to work full time in the Lafayette, CA office throughout the co-op term and ability to travel locally for job site inspections and field work. Visa sponsorship is not available for this position.
• Skills: Strong interpersonal and communication skills, proficiency with Microsoft Word and Excel, and the ability to work both independently and with a team.
• Bonus: AutoCAD and REVIT experience is preferred.
